Aistaland GX7 Interior Makes Public Debut
Aistaland GX7, a large five-seat SUV developed jointly by Guangzhou Automobile Group Co., Ltd (GAC Group) and Huawei Technologies Co., Ltd (Huawei), has made its interior debut ahead of its appearance at the 2026 Chengdu Motor Show. Developed under the Aistaland brand by Aistaland Intelligent Automotive Technology (Guangzhou) Co., Ltd (Aistaland Auto), the model focuses heavily on passenger comfort, flexible seating and an advanced cockpit experience. Its interior introduces several distinctive features, including four zero-gravity seats, a rear-seat mechanism that folds the backrests rearward to 180 degrees, and a large cargo area that can be expanded to 2,215 L.
Flexible Seating And Enhanced Cabin Practicality
The cabin adopts a wraparound cockpit layout designed around comfort and convenience for occupants. The model is fitted with four zero-gravity seats, while its rear seats feature an industry-first rearward-folding design that can be unfolded to 180 degrees at the touch of a button. This arrangement is intended to increase flexibility for passengers during longer journeys or when the vehicle is stationary. Practicality is further supported by a maximum trunk capacity of 2,215 L, while a 10 L heating and cooling refrigerator provides additional onboard storage and can be accessed from either side by the driver or front passenger.
HarmonySpace 6 Introduces AI-Enabled Cockpit Interaction
The SUV also places strong emphasis on intelligent in-vehicle interaction through the HarmonySpace 6 intelligent cockpit. The model is among the first vehicles to feature the platform and introduces what the company describes as the industry’s first cockpit AI agent with full-scenario, cross-domain interaction. The system is designed to support functions spanning navigation, food ordering, conversation and vehicle control, bringing multiple cockpit tasks into a unified interaction experience. The approach reflects a broader move toward AI-enabled vehicle interfaces that combine infotainment, assistance and control functions within the cabin, with Huawei Technologies Co., Ltd supplying key intelligent cockpit technologies.
Dual Displays And 88-Inch Huawei XHUD
Display and driver-information technology are another major part of the interior package. The model uses Huawei’s dual 15.6-inch intelligent in-vehicle displays with High Dynamic Range (HDR) image enhancement, a technology intended to maintain clear image visibility even under bright sunlight. It also features the next-generation Huawei XHUD, an 88-inch augmented reality head-up display (AR-HUD). The system can present navigation arrows, vehicle speed and intelligent driving information within the driver’s forward field of view, helping reduce the need to look away from the road while accessing key vehicle information. Together, these technologies reinforce the vehicle’s focus on connected and immersive cockpit functionality.
